Muthoot, born in 1949, inherited a legacy. The Muthoot Group, founded in 1887, had already established itself in the trade of timber and food grains. However, Muthoot wasn't content with merely preserving the past. He envisioned a future where the group would not only endure but flourish. As he said,

"The greatest danger for most of us is not that our aim is too high and we miss it, but that it is too low and we reach it."

This ambition propelled him to take the reins of the company in 1979, ushering in an era of phenomenal growth. M.G. George Muthoot was a prominent Indian entrepreneur and businessman, known for his leadership in The Muthoot Group. He graduated in Mechanical Engineering from Manipal Institute of Technology and later attended Executive Management Courses at Harvard Business School. Joining the family business at a young age, he became the Managing Director in 1979 and Chairman in 1993. Under his leadership, The Muthoot Group expanded into a conglomerate with 20 diversified divisions and a significant international presence. Muthoot Finance Limited, the flagship company, became India's largest gold financing company.

One of Muthoot's most significant decisions was to focus on gold financing. He recognized the potential in this niche market, understanding the financial needs of a vast segment of the Indian population. Under his leadership, Muthoot Finance, the group's flagship company, transformed into the nation's leading gold financier. This focus, coupled with strategic diversification into other financial services, laid the foundation for the Muthoot Group's remarkable expansion.

Awards and Recognition

Muthoot's leadership wasn't solely defined by financial acumen. He was a man of exceptional character, recognized for his social responsibility and commitment to community development. He was conferred the prestigious "SKOCH Financial Inclusion Award" in 2013, a testament to his dedication to making financial services accessible to all. He received various national and international awards, including the 'AIMA Emerging Business Leader of the Year Award' and the 'Golden Peacock Award for Excellence in Business Leadership.' M.G.
